The term “lottery” derives from the Dutch noun “lot,” which means fate. Throughout the centuries, it has been used in many different contexts, including military conscription, commercial promotions in which property is given away by a random procedure, and the selection of jurors from lists of registered voters. Modern lotteries are often considered a type of gambling because they require payment in exchange for the chance to win a prize, and the prizes are usually money or goods. However, the legal definition of a lottery differs from that of gambling. In the case of a lottery, payment is a consideration, while gambling requires a wager on a future event. For this reason, most governments regulate the operation of lottery games. While some prohibit them entirely, most limit the number of players and the prizes offered. In the 15th century, the first recorded lotteries involving money prizes were held in the Low Countries. Various towns in these countries began holding public lottery fundraisers to help with the state’s finances. Francis I of France allowed lotteries in several cities in the 1520s. The oldest known European lottery is the Staatsloterij of Ghent. It was started in 1445. The Dutch word lottery derives from the noun “fate”.

In colonial America, there were as many as 200 lotteries. The money raised from these lotteries financed roads, bridges, schools, and canals. Many of these lottery proceeds helped finance the building of several American colleges. The Continental Congress also used the proceeds of a lottery to fund the Colonial Army. During the French and Indian War, several colonies used lotteries as a way to raise money. The Massachusetts lottery, for instance, raised money for the “Expedition against Canada” in 1758.
